What you can expect:

  • RN’s working in the NeST ICU will care for post operative patients along with patients with traumatic brain injuries, spinal cord injuries, seizures, strokes, and other neurological disorders

  • This will be a fast paced, high-pressure environment that will care for some of the area’s highest acuity neuro patients

  • To be part of a unit that consists of 18 critical care beds and 17 step down beds

  • The unit offers strong leadership and great opportunities for growth and advancement

What you will need to start work with us:

  • Licensed as a Registered Nurse in Idaho

  • BLS certification at date of hire

  • American Heart Association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support for HealthCare Provider (ACLS) certification within 6 months of hire

  • Pediatric Advanced Life Support (PALS) certification within 12 months of hire
